The cards should be numbers except 1 King and 1 ace.If P1 gets the king, he's the murderer.If P2 gets the ace, she's the detective.Everyone else is a citizen.As a narrator, the other person sat.The narrator said loudly, "all the people in the town went to bed.Everyone bowed their heads and closed their eyes.
Then the narrator called, "the killer wakes up.\ "P1 raised his head and opened his eyes.He was referring to the victims."The killer went back to sleep.\ "The Killer closed his eyes and bowed his head again.
The detective woke up.
P2 looked up and pointed to the person she thought was the murderer.The narrator nodded yes or no.The detective went to bed.The people in the town woke up.Everyone looked up.Joe was killed last night."Joe quit the game.The group tried to decide who the killer was.They can ask for an alibi, etc.They finally decided to hang a man for murder.
This is determined by a majority vote.
If they do "hang" the killer, the game is over.If not, repeat the sequence.The people in the town went to bed, the killer murdered someone, the detective pointed out a guess about who the killer was and wanted to be affirmed by the narrator, the people in the town woke up and died another personThe group again tried to decide who was the murderer and who would be hanged.Anyone can claim to be a detective and "know" who the murderer is.
Even the murderer himself can claim to be the detective who found Jenny the murderer from the narrator.The real detective should be wary of letting her know where she is, because if the killer knows, he will put her first on the list.If the killer only kills one person, he wins.
If you have a lot of people, you can also add an extra killer and/or detective (they all look up when the narrator tells them.They must all agree to choose the person who killed/convicted by silently pointing, nodding and/or shaking their heads.You can also add a queen to a bunch of cards.
This person is a nurse.
The narrator wakes the murderer and the detective to sleep, and he wakes up the nurse.The nurse will point to a person to "save" and go back to sleep.If that particular person is the one the murderer is trying to kill, then the narrator will announce after telling the people in the town to wake up, "No one has been killed.

When a person drops any object, he has to leave the game, but his object stays in the game.As the game progresses, more and more people leave the game because there are more objects than people, so it is more and more difficult to avoid falling objects.The winner is the last person left.11.Rabbit, cow, elephant: form a circle with one person as the center.
The person would point to someone in the circle and say "rabbit" (or cow, or elephant ).) The person being pointed must form the front paw of the rabbit, and the person on both sides must raise an arm as the ear of the Rabbit.The goal is to have people in the center tag one of the three before forming a "rabbit.
If it is called "cow", then the person pointing must form a breast with his finger, and the other two must form an angle."Elephant" is the chosen person, is the trunk, two people outside must form a big ear.---Where the "flight attendant" is one of the options, it is also played.
